Farmington- Rodney A. Adams Sr, 81, passed away on November 11, 2023. He was born in Farmington, ME on May 7, 1942, to Hartland and Lucille (Kennedy) Adams. He graduated in 1960 from the former Farmington High School.
He married Helen Kinney in 1961, Evelyn Pinkham in 1964 and Rodene Mayhew in 1973.
He was a long-term resident of Manchester, NH where he worked in construction as a heavy equipment operator. After retiring in 2004, he spent many happy hours fishing, hunting, four wheeling and snowmobiling with his brother, Bud. Growing up he developed a lifelong friendship with Rodney "Cookie" Cook and told many riotous tales of their shenanigans. Rodney was a resident of Edgewood Rehab and Living Center where he enjoyed joking with the staff. They never had to guess what he was thinking.
He was predeceased by brothers Harold and Rolan and a sister Joyce Lovell.
He is survived by sisters- Beulah Libby of Fairfield and Linda Martin of Oakland. His children- Kevin Libby and wife Mary, Kelly Cartwright and husband Gene, Rodney Adams Jr. and wife Jaccie of Alaska, Ronica Leland of Waterville, Roberta Messer of Farmington and Raedene Cote and husband Mike of Emden; several grandchildren, great grandchildren, nieces, and nephew.
